Computation of endo-fixed closures in free-abelian times free groups

Abstract

In this paper, we explore the behaviour of the fixed subgroups of endomorphisms of free-abelian times free (FATF) groups. We exhibit an algorithm which, given a finitely generated subgroup H of a FATF group G, decides whether H is the fixed subgroup of some (finite) family of endomorphisms of G and, in the affirmative case, it finds such a family. The algorithm combines both combinatorial and algebraic methods.
